Economy & Jobs

Mountain View residents earn a median household income of $55,781 , which is 26% below the national average of $75,149. Per capita income is $31,407. The unemployment rate stands at 0.4% (89% below the U.S. rate of 3.6%). 13.3% of residents live below the poverty line. The area is home to 294 business establishments, including 9 restaurants.

Housing & Cost of Living

The median home value in Mountain View is $75,300 , 73% below the national median of $281,900. Zillow estimates the typical home at $88,232. Median rent is $566/month, with 32.5% of renters spending more than 30% of income on housing. The cost of living index is 87.8 (100 = national average). The median home was built in 1959.

Safety & Crime

Mountain View reports 0 violent crimes per 100,000 residents , which is 100% below the national average of 380/100K. Property crime is 1,102/100K. The murder rate is 0.0/100K.

Education

20.2% of adults in Mountain View hold a bachelor's degree or higher (40% below the national average). 96.1% have completed high school. Local schools score 5.3/10 in standardized testing.

Climate & Weather

Mountain View has an average annual temperature of 61°F (16°C). Winters average 39°F in January while summers reach 83°F in July. The area gets 318 sunny days per year.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 45.
